Inflammation Antibody Array features 94 antibodies for profiling major inflammatory factors including interleukins, chemokines, and other cytokines in human cells, tissues, serum or culture media.
Inflammation Antibody Array is a high-throughput ELISA based antibody array for profiling of major inflammatory factors including cytokines, chemokines and related biomarkers. The array is designed for comparing normal samples to treated or diseased samples, screening and identifying candidate biomarkers.
Key Features:
· 94 inflammation factor antibodies; 6 replicates per antibody
· Qualitative/semi-quantitative protein expression profiling of cytokines and related biomarkers
· Antibodies covalently immobilized on 3D polymer coated glass slide
· Fluorescent detection

Assay Outline:
The ELISA based Explorer Antibody Array platform involves four major steps:
· Protein extraction with non-denaturing lysis buffer
· Biotinylation of protein samples
· Incubation of labeled samples with antibody array
